LensOCR is an optical character recognition (OCR) software that can extract text from images. It allows users to take photos of documents, receipts, notes, and whiteboards, and converts them into digital, editable text. Useful for digitizing paper documents and making text searchable.

Linux Distro Chooser is a website that helps users select the right Linux distribution to install based on their needs and preferences. It asks questions about use case, skill level, preferred desktop environment, etc. and suggests suitable distros.
